The moon passes through all twelve signs of the zodiac each month, and biodynamic growers match what they sow to the element the moon is travelling through. In December 2026 the moon is ascending in southern skies — the traditional time for sowing and grafting — on 17 days. The strongest sowing dates fall on the 1, 2, 3 and 12 other days. Days marked in the table below sit near a lunar node or perigee, when traditional practice is to leave the soil alone.

Southern hemisphere. Moon phases and day types are the same the world over — a root day in Sussex is a root day in Canterbury. What changes is that ascending and descending are reversed, because the moon climbs southern skies as its declination moves south, and the sowing lists follow southern seasons.

What to sow in December

🌱 Root Days10 in December

Best for root vegetables — carrots, beetroot, potatoes, onions

🥬 Leaf Days7 in December

Best for leafy greens — lettuce, spinach, chard, herbs for leaf

🌸 Flower Days6 in December

Best for flowering plants, brassicas and herbs

🍅 Fruit Days8 in December

Best for fruiting plants — tomatoes, courgettes, beans, apples
